No. of bitstreams: 1 2016_dis_jcmlopes.pdf: 4310254 bytes, checksum: b3ac63c58791d30d4058113b7028a1b1 (MD5) Previous issue date: 2016 / This research is motivated in a dialogue between the Lotes Vagos: Coletive Action on a Experimental Urban Ocupation, from the artists Breno Silva and Louise Ganz, and the concepts of common and community, as Giorgio Agamben have discussed it, as well as others that touch the formulation of those ones, such as what is called improper, time, space and invention. The project happened in Belo Horizonte (2005/2006) and Fortaleza (2008), this last one being our main object, composed with seven occupations. Lotes Vagos proposed the temporary occupation of urban vacancies. As a method, the artists made an agreement with the owners of the lands meanwhile opened the invitation to any propositions. In many possibilities of interpretations, Lotes Vagos made evident the public character given to a private space. In others, the project presents an invitation to open up a space to a reinvention of the self. During this investigation, it was possible to understand that whatever, concept developed by Agamben, the one who, in anyway, matters, is the main participant of the propositions on the urban vacancies. It became clear, also, that both artists and whatever user made the action happen. / Esta pesquisa está motivada em um diálogo entre o projeto Lotes Vagos: Ação Coletiva de Ocupação Urbana Experimental, dos artistas Breno Silva e Louise Ganz, e os conceitos de comum e comunidade segundo o filósofo italiano Giorgio Agamben, bem como outros que atravessam a formulação destes, como impropriedade, tempo, espaço e invenção. Motion and forces : a view of students' ideas in relation to physics teaching

Vasconcelos, Nilza Maria Vilhena Nunes da Costa January 1987 (has links)
This study concerns students' ideas about the existence or otherwise of forces in several dynamical situations involving moving objects and objects at rest. It aims to contribute to a better understanding of students' ideas about dynamics. It differs from previous research (a) in covering a wider-range among students and larger variation in taught Physics background. (b) in attempting to tap less verbal forms of evidence and (c) in attempting to avoid 'scientifism' in terms of the way to approach students and in terms of interpreting results. The empirical part of the study involved 338 students from seven different groups. Data was collected from the above sample. using a questionnaire to which responses were simply graphic indications of the directions of expected forces. and. if possible. the giving of names to these forces. in eight situations presented diagrammatically. In addition. data was collected from a sub-sample. by means of computer games using a screen 'object' obeying Newtonian Mechanics. in a frictional and a non-frictional 'environment'. under the control of the subject. Difficulties in interpreting the last kind of data led to the main study being focussed on the results of the questionnaire. Some results from the computer games are however presented. They are mainly concerned with students' performance when playing in a frictional versus non-frictional 'environment'. Results suggest a better students' performance when playing in a frictional 'environment'. Results obtained with the questionnaire concern: (a) differences between situations in patterns of expected directions. among students of the same group and between groups. Generally the results suggest the existence of common patterns among the students of the same group and systematic differences between patterns of groups with an increase in exposure to physics teaching. namely the attribution of new force directions [e.g. vertical and downwards. opposite to motion). despite the persistence of primitive ideas (e.g. a force along the motion); (b) names given to the different kinds of forces in various directions. Results include a difficulty found in naming forces which existed before teaching. They also give information about how scientific terms are assimilated. Interpretations of the results. mainly taken from a theory of Common Sense Reasoning about motions proposed by Ogborn (1985). seem to give them a reasonable explanation. Although requiring further investigation. this gives some support to claim that students' intuitive ideas about dynamics should be regarded [i] as deriving from a rather general and coherent set of ideas, [ii] as less formalized in terms of the scientific world view and [iii] as having their origin mainly in actions on the world.
